在讲解语法知识前,先把基础工作做好:
一、什么是python?
2.1 他是一门高级的编程语言(不用去了解底层操作的具体过程)
2.2 他是应用特别广泛的语言: 面板/数据分析/前后端开发/爬虫....
2.3 高可读性,强缩进,极简
二、开发工具:pycharm以及python(具体下载方法搜索csdn)
好!那下面开始进入正题了!
一、输出函数print()
# print(打印的内容[可以写多个],以什么分割,以什么结束)
# 1.打印的内容可以有多个
# 2.默认的分割符号是空格,可以通过 sep="目标分隔符"
# 3.打印结束以后,使用end="目标结束符" 去结束这段话,默认(若不规定end是啥)则是换行
print('我爱', '学python', '和', '和英语', sep='+', end='===')
print('其实数学也不错')
二、变量
- 定义:
计算机用来存储可变数据的内存空间---我的硬盘上面有很多"学习资料"1. 内存相当于一个一个的坑2. 我们放在内存里面的数据(人),相当于内存里面的某一个位置(坑)里面有一个人3. 坑对外显示的是这个人的身份证号,不利于交流,一般就给人一个姓名(变量名)4. 人(身份证号/类型/内容)
- 变量的命名:
1.字母,数字,下划线,首字符不能为数字,可以使用中文,但是不建议2.大小写敏感,建议都使用小写,多个单词之间需要拼接,使用下划线user_name user_score cls_num last_person3.不到万不得已,不要使用中式英文de_fen4.赋值才能使用如:
武当掌门 = '张三丰' 华山掌门 = 武当掌门 武当掌门 = '张无忌' print(华山掌门)
运行结果如下:
三、输入与输出
- 输出
name = '迪迦奥特曼' age = 3000000 salary = 9999.168 # 1.%写法 print('我的姓名:%s' %name) # %s表示一个字符串 print('我的年龄:%d' %age) # %d表示一个整数 print('我的薪资:%.1f' %salary) # %f 表示小数 可以使用%.xf表示去x为有效数字 # 2.format写法 print('我的姓名:{}'.format(name)) print('我的年龄:{},我的薪资:{}'.format(age,salary)) # 3.f-string ,需要py3.6版本以上 print(f'我的姓名:{name}') print(f'我的年龄:{age},我的薪资:{salary}')
- 输入
# 接受用户输入的数据 # input函数他会根据用户在控制台输入的内容进行显示,结果的类型是字符串 user_str = input('请输入您的姓名:') sect = input('请输入您的家乡:') hobby = input('您的兴趣是:') print(f'您输入的姓名是:{user_str},您的家乡是:{sect},您的兴趣爱好是:{hobby}') print(type(user_str)) # tips:小技巧 user_new = int(user_str) print(type(user_new))
3.插播一条消息如果你需要ip池子的话,不妨试试我在用的ip池: